"The history of Wuhan University can be traced back to Ziqiang Institute, which was founded in 1893 by Zhang Zhidong [also Chang Chih-tung] (1837-1909), the then governor of Hubei Province and Hunan Province in the late Qing Dynasty... In 1878, the radical Chinese nationalist, Zhang Zhidong, wrote his essay Quan Xue Pian ('China’s Exhortation to Study (and Conquer)') in which he elaborated upon the concept of ti-yong, which meant to 'keep China’s style of learning to maintain societal essence and adopt Western learning for practical use.'” [link to spectator.org (secure)] (less than 50%) [Zhang] "vigorously pressed the late Ch'ing self-strengthening program, establishing an arsenal, iron-and-steelworks, military and naval academies, and schools of mining, agriculture, commerce and industry. [He] encouraged the early reform movement between 1895 and 1898 (see K'ang Yu-wei), advocating a balance between study of the Chinese heritage and adoption of Western scientific and technical knowledge."
